### Escalation: Slow Autocomplete Index

If the Fernwick autocomplete index shows p95 latency above 400ms for more than ten minutes, begin by checking the indexer backlog on the Meadowline dashboard. A backlog over 50k documents usually means a stalled refresh worker; restart it once using the documented procedure, then wait five minutes. Do not restart it a second time, as repeated restarts can corrupt the shard map. If latency has not recovered after one restart, escalate to the search platform team at the address below.

alerts address for kajog-tadup: druox@plorvanet.internal

Before release sign-off, confirm the Tallygrove sidecar is pinned to the approved image digest and that its scrape allowlist excludes the Dunmere billing pods. Verify that aggregation windows are set to 60 seconds, that dropped-sample counters are exported, and that the sidecar's memory limit matches the capacity review from the Larkhall planning doc. Any deviation must be documented in the release notes with a remediation date. All exceptions require written approval from the sidecar's accountable owner, named directly below.

named custodian: Brivan Eliath Quenox Frador

- [ ] Before the Quillhaven signing ceremony proceeds, run the leaked-file-descriptor hunt on the offline signer. As a new contractor, please be thorough: enumerate every open descriptor on the sealed host, confirm nothing points at the ceremony scratch volume, and log each finding in the Larkspur register. If any descriptor traces back to the retired Fenwick exporter, halt and page the ceremony lead. Once the host shows a clean descriptor table, unlock the escrow envelope using the phrase below.

unlock words, yajof-tagef: aldiel-kasath-briax-fraeth-pelius-olieth-pelix-wenius-wenael-norael

## Releases

Validata releases are cut monthly from the stable branch. Each plugin bundle is built in the Orlest CI pipeline, versioned, and signed before publication to the internal registry. Contractors should verify bundles before local installs; unsigned plugins will not load. The current release signing key is included below for verification.

deploy key for bawig-tajop: bky9_PQ3GVoQw1